Sat 5 August 2023 Clun Carnival

Saturday August 5.

Several events the week preceding the carnival, starting with an Art & Craft Exhibition in the Hightown Community Room). On Show Day, August 5, a procession including marchers, carnival floats and historic vehicles starts a tour of the town at 1.00 pm followed by Crowning of the Carnival Queen in The Square. From 2 pm there will be a large horticultural and homecraft show on the Castle Meadow, together with a tea tent, bar, stalls and entertainments including a bouncy castle and other attractions free to children.
